探秘数据提取利器:Sammler
在这个信息爆炸的时代,从海量的文本资料中快速准确地提取关键数据变得至关重要。为此,我们很高兴向您推荐一款名为Sammler的开源工具,它专注于从文本文档和字符串中智能抽取重要信息。
项目介绍
Sammler是一个强大的数据提取工具,通过简单的命令行界面,它能够识别并提取电子邮件地址、IP地址、MAC地址、日期时间、信用卡号、域名以及电话号码等关键数据。无论你是网络安全专家,还是数据分析人员,或者是日常处理大量文本信息的人,Sammler都能成为您的得力助手。
项目技术分析
Sammler的核心在于其高效的数据模式匹配算法。它能以极高的精度识别各种类型的数据,并且支持批量处理多个文件。用户可以灵活使用-f/--file
选项指定待检查的文件,或者使用-a/--all
一次性搜索当前目录下的所有文件。这一切都基于简洁明了的命令行操作,使得集成到自动化流程中变得轻松容易。
此外,Sammler的设计者们还非常注重隐私保护。该项目采用了MIT许可,意味着您可以自由使用、修改和分发,而且源代码的开放性保证了工具的安全透明。
项目及技术应用场景
- 网络安全:监控日志文件,发现可能的攻击源或异常行为。
- 数据分析:在大规模文本数据集中快速定位关键信息,如消费者联系方式,进行进一步研究。
- 信息管理:整理邮件,快速提取联系人信息,提高工作效率。
- 学术研究:从文献中自动收集作者邮箱、日期等元数据,简化文献管理。
- 开发测试:验证API返回或日志记录中的数据是否符合预期格式。
项目特点
- 多格式支持:覆盖多种常见数据类型,满足多样化需求。
- 便捷的命令行接口:易于使用,无需复杂的配置,一键启动。
- 批量处理:支持同时处理多个文件,提升处理效率。
- 高准确性:精准的数据识别算法,确保提取结果的可靠性。
- 开源许可证:遵循MIT协议,允许自由使用和二次开发。
无论是个人工作,还是团队协作,Sammler都是一个值得信赖的数据提取工具。现在就加入Sammler的社区,让您的数据处理变得更加简单高效!